  POLICY 307.02 Lanterman-Petris-Short Detention
 
  PROCEDURES
  1. Programs eligible as approved sites to initiate assessments for involuntary detention include, but are not limited to:
     
    1. Outpatient programs with emergency assessment capacity;
    2. Full Service Partnership (FSP) programs;
    3. Urgent Care Centers (UCCs);
    4. Mental health field response teams; and
    5. Psychiatric Health Facilities (PHFs).
       
  2. Programs shall seek and obtain specific approval from the DMH Director to become a site authorized to employ staff eligible to initiate an application for involuntary detention. 
     
  3. All Lanterman-Petris-Short (LPS) approved programs shall maintain the capacity to perform this function.
     
  4. All LPS approved programs shall have staff available to assess any individual in need during the program's normal hours of operation.
     
  5. All LPS approved programs shall conduct LPS evaluations consistent with California WIC Sections 5150 and 5585.
